Orchard Tree Pruning in San Jose, CA
Orchard tree pruning services involve carefully trimming and shaping fruit and nut trees to promote healthy growth, improve fruit production, and maintain the overall appearance of the trees. This process can include removing dead or diseased branches, thinning out dense areas, and shaping the canopy to ensure proper air circulation and sunlight exposure. Homeowners often request orchard pruning for established trees that need rejuvenation, young trees that require training, or trees that have become overgrown and are affecting the health of surrounding plants or structures.
Before requesting orchard tree pruning, property owners typically want to understand the scope of the work, including which branches will be removed and how the pruning will affect the tree’s growth and fruit yield. It’s also helpful to consider the timing of pruning, as certain types of trees benefit from being pruned during specific seasons to maximize health and productivity. Clarifying these details can ensure the pruning aligns with the health and aesthetics of the orchard or landscape.

Common Orchard Tree Pruning Jobs
Orchard Tree Pruning - involves removing dead or overgrown branches to promote healthy growth.
Fruit Tree Pruning - enhances fruit production and improves the tree’s shape and structure.
Crown Thinning - reduces canopy density to improve sunlight penetration and airflow.
Structural Pruning - corrects branch weaknesses and prevents potential storm damage.
Formative Pruning - shapes young trees to establish a strong, balanced structure.
Seasonal Pruning - maintains tree health and appearance throughout the year.
Orchard Tree Pruning Questions
Why is pruning orchard trees important? Proper pruning helps maintain tree health, encourages fruit production, and prevents overgrowth that can lead to damage or disease.
When is the best time to prune orchard trees? The ideal time is during the dormant season, typically late winter to early spring, before new growth begins.
What types of pruning are performed on orchard trees? Techniques include thinning out crowded branches, removing dead or diseased wood, and shaping the tree for better sunlight exposure.
How does pruning affect fruit yield? Regular pruning can improve fruit quality and increase overall yield by allowing better airflow and sunlight penetration.
